Subject: Re: [PATCH] KVM: s390: pci: Hook to access KVM lowlevel from VFIO
Date: Thu, 18 Aug 2022 11:13:56 -0400 [thread overview]
Message-ID: <d874d06d-359d-0cc2-283b-cf4cfd5789e9@linux.ibm.com> (raw)
In-Reply-To: <25e2364a71c52651f5227c0bc3f43fd193bc2e08.camel@linux.ibm.com>
On 8/18/22 10:20 AM, Niklas Schnelle wrote:
> On Thu, 2022-08-18 at 09:33 -0400, Matthew Rosato wrote:
>> On 8/18/22 6:23 AM, Pierre Morel wrote:
>>> We have a cross dependency between KVM and VFIO.
>>
>> maybe add something like 'when using s390 vfio_pci_zdev extensions for PCI passthrough'
>>
>>> To be able to keep both subsystem modular we add a registering
>>> hook inside the S390 core code.
>>>
>>> This fixes a build problem when VFIO is built-in and KVM is built
>>> as a module or excluded.
>>
>> s/or excluded//
>>
>> There's no problem when KVM is excluded, that forces CONFIG_VFIO_PCI_ZDEV_KVM=n because of the 'depends on S390 && KVM'.
>>
>>> Reported-by: Randy Dunlap <rdunlap@infradead.org>
>>> Reported-by: kernel test robot <lkp@intel.com>
>>> Signed-off-by: Pierre Morel <pmorel@linux.ibm.com>
>>> Fixes: 09340b2fca007 ("KVM: s390: pci: add routines to start/stop inter..")
>>> Cc: <stable@vger.kernel.org>
>>> ---
>>> arch/s390/include/asm/kvm_host.h | 17 ++++++-----------
>>> arch/s390/kvm/pci.c | 10 ++++++----
>>> arch/s390/pci/Makefile | 2 ++
>>> arch/s390/pci/pci_kvm_hook.c | 11 +++++++++++
>>> drivers/vfio/pci/vfio_pci_zdev.c | 8 ++++++--
>>> 5 files changed, 31 insertions(+), 17 deletions(-)
>>> create mode 100644 arch/s390/pci/pci_kvm_hook.c
>>>
>>> diff --git a/arch/s390/include/asm/kvm_host.h b/arch/s390/include/asm/kvm_host.h
>>> index f39092e0ceaa..8312ed9d1937 100644
>>> --- a/arch/s390/include/asm/kvm_host.h
>>> +++ b/arch/s390/include/asm/kvm_host.h
